How to Pick the Right Pile Seal for Your Shed

Choosing the right seal requires assessing the specific conditions of the shed door. Start by measuring the gap width—the space between the door and the frame—when the door is closed. If the gap is inconsistent, choose a longer pile that can compress in tight areas while still filling the wider sections.

Consider the environment as well. High-humidity areas demand moisture-resistant synthetic materials to prevent mold or rot within the seal itself. Additionally, think about frequency of use; a shed used for a few hours in spring requires less durability than a year-round workspace that is accessed daily in harsh weather.

Measuring and Installing Your New Pile Seal

Accuracy is the difference between a draft-free shed and a wasted afternoon. Use a flexible measuring tape to check the gap at three points: the top, middle, and bottom of the door. Always buy five percent more material than the total perimeter measurement to account for trimming errors or corner overlaps.

When installing, start from the top and work downward, ensuring the seal is pressed firmly into place. For adhesive versions, apply firm, even pressure along the entire length to activate the glue. Never stretch the material during installation, as it will naturally contract over time and leave unsightly gaps at the corners.

Maintaining Seals for Year-Round Protection

Pile seals are not maintenance-free components. Once a year, usually during the seasonal switch, vacuum the dust and cobwebs out of the fibers to keep the pile upright and functional. If the pile begins to lay flat and loses its “loft,” use a stiff brush to gently fluff the fibers back into position.

Inspect the seals for signs of degradation, such as cracking adhesive or chewed edges. Catching these issues early prevents small energy leaks from turning into large-scale infestations or rot. Keeping the area immediately around the door clear of debris also prevents premature wear on the material.

More Ways to Draft-Proof Your Potting Shed

Weatherstripping is only the first line of defense in an energy-efficient shed. Check the threshold beneath the door, as this is often where the largest drafts occur; a heavy-duty rubber door sweep can work in tandem with a pile seal to create a complete airtight perimeter. Seal gaps around window frames with a simple exterior-grade caulk to stop air infiltration.

For larger gaps or cracks in the shed siding, consider using expanding foam specifically formulated for outdoor use. If the roof-to-wall joints are drafty, a simple bead of silicone can bridge those seams. These layered approaches ensure that the effort spent on pile seals isn’t undermined by air leaks elsewhere in the structure.
